1 definition by Nigel Petersen

Top Definition
Dimethyltryptamine (DMT) is a powerful, visual psychedelic which produces short-acting effects when smoked. It is used orally in combination with an MAOI, as in ayahuasca brews. It is naturally produced in the human brain and by many plants
after smokin deemsters and listenin to iggy pop under a waterfall i woke up in the back of a cop car with my dick lookin redder than a lobster
by Nigel Petersen November 01, 2007

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.